In recent years, the international landscape regarding cannabis has shifted significantly. From the overall legalization in Canada and Thailand to the state-level reforms in the United States, the world is increasingly seeing marijuana through a lens of guideline and tax instead of prohibition. Nevertheless, this global trend does not apply everywhere. Among the most considerable exceptions to this wave of liberalization is the Russian Federation.
For those researching the topic of acquiring or having marijuana in Russia, it is vital to comprehend that the nation maintains a few of the strictest drug laws in the world. This article offers an extensive introduction of the legal structure, the dangers included, and the present cultural climate surrounding cannabis in Russia.
The Russian legal system does not identify between "soft" and "tough" drugs in the method some Western legal systems do. Under the Criminal Code of the Russian Federation, any involvement with illegal drugs is treated with extreme seriousness.

In Russia, the seriousness of the punishment is heavily depending on the weight of the substance took. The following table details the limits for cannabis (cannabis) as specified by the Russian government.
| Quantity Class | Weight (Grams) | Legal Classification | Prospective Penalties |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small Amount | Under 6g | Administrative Offense | Great (4,000-- 5,000 RUB) or approximately 15 days detention. |
| Considerable Amount | 6g to 100g | Wrongdoer Offense (Art. 228) | Up to 3 years in jail, heavy fines, or obligatory labor. |
| Large Amount | 100g to 100kg | Crime (Art. 228) | 3 to 10 years in prison plus significant fines. |
| Especially Large | Over 100kg | Wrongdoer Offense (Art. 228) | 10 to 15 years in jail. |
Note: These weights describe the dried plant product. For hashish, the weight thresholds are significantly lower (Significant quantity starts at 2g).
While the law technically allows for administrative fines for amounts under 6 grams, the truth of the Russian judicial system is often more stiff. It is not uncommon for people found with even "small" quantities to face extreme cops scrutiny.
Law enforcement in Russia is known for its "zero-tolerance" policy. There are frequent reports of "incitement" or "planting" of proof, although the federal government formally rejects these practices. For a foreigner, any encounter with the authorities regarding illegal drugs is likely to lead to instant detention and participation of the embassy.

| Compound | Legal Status |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| THC (Marijuana) | Illegal | Restricted for leisure and medical usage. |
| CBD Oil | Gray Area/Illegal | Most CBD items consist of trace amounts of THC. If any THC is discovered, it is dealt with as an unlawful narcotic. |
| Industrial Hemp | Legal | Allowed for industrial usage (fiber, oilseeds) if THC content is listed below 0.1%. |
| Medical Cannabis | Prohibited | No provisions exist for medical cannabis prescriptions. |
